1.Biological Sciences: Its importance and human welfare, Branches of Biology, Biologists, Reputed Biological Institutions in India
2.Living World: Life and its Characteristics, Classification of Living Organisms
3.Microbial World: Virus, Bacteria, Algae, Fungi and Protozoan, Useful and Harmful Micro-organisms
4.Cell & Tissues: Cell - Structural and Functional unit of life. Prokaryotic and Eukaryotic Cell, Structure of Eukaryotic Cell, Cell Organelles, Differences between Plant Cell and Animal Cell, Cell Division – Mitosis and Meiosis, Tissues – Structure, Functions and Types of Plant and Animal tissues.
5.Plant World: Morphology of a Typical Plant – Root, Stem, Leaf, Flower, Inflorescence, Fruit - their Structure, Types and Functions, Parts of a Flower, Modifications of Root, Stem and Leaf, Photosynthesis, Transpiration, Transportation (Ascent of Sap), Respiration, Excretion and Reproduction in Plants, Plant Hormones, Economic importance of Plants, Wild and Cultivated Plants, Agricultural Operations, Crop diseases and Control measures, Improvement in Crop yield, Storage, Preservation and Protection of Food and Plant Products
6.Animal World: Organs and Organ Systems including man – Their Structure and Functions Digestive, Respiratory, Circulatory, Excretory, Nervous, Control and Co-ordination and Reproductive, Sense Organs: Structure and Functions of Eye, Ear, Nose, Tongue and Skin. Nutrition in man – Nutrients and their functions, Balanced Diet, Deficiency diseases, Tropical diseases, Skin diseases, Blindness in man: Causes, Prevention and Control, Health agencies, First Aid – Bites: Insect, Scorpion and Snakes, Fractures, Accidents, Life skills, Wild and Domesticated animals, Economic Importance of Animals, Animal Husbandry – Pisciculture, Sericulture, Poultry, Breeding of Cows and Buffaloes
7.Our Environment: Abiotic and Biotic factors and Ecosystems, Natural Resources – Classification, Judicial use of Renewable, Non-renewable and Alternative Resources, Wild Life - Conservation, Sanctuaries, National Parks in India, Bio-Geochemical Cycles, Pollution – Air, Water, Soil and Sound Global Environmental issues – Global Warming (Green House Effect), Acid Rains and Depletion of Ozone layer
8.World of Energy: Work and Energy, Energy transformation, Need for Energy in living organisms, Basal Metabolic Rate (BMR), Energy relations in Ecosystems, Bio-mass and Bio-fuels, Non-Conventional Energy sources
9.Recent Trends in Biology: Hybridization, Genetic Engineering, Gene Bank, Gene Therapy, Tissue Culture and Bio-Technology
